Meet your host family: Emma in France

COPY : NEW - Come and learn English with Emma and Stephen in the sunny Vendee, France!

We are a brother and sister who both wanted to move to France and decided to pool our resources and buy a large house together, allowing us to live independently yet not alone!
My brother has a film production company and is passionate about his work, music and cars and I teach English (TEFL qualified) both at home and online and I have a love of horses and, in fact, am lucky enough to have 2 at home.
We live in the beautiful and sunny Vendee region, which has plenty on offer, including wonderful beaches, canals, forests, lakes and miles of walking and cycling trails, as well as a wealth of attractions to visit.

We are happy to host people across most ages and capabilities including people with specific language needs such as TOIEC exam preparation or business language skills. I am TEFL qualified and have been teaching English as a foreign language for several years and Stephen has a degree in English.

We can host up to 2 people at a time - family members, friends or work colleagues!

We are full time French residents, have clean police background checks and up-to-date public liability insurance that covers us for tourist stays.

For under 18's we offer Full Board Immersion stays during which they spend the majority of their day with us and get involved in our daily life - so maybe helping with the horses, doing a bit of gardening or diy (supervised), cooking and baking, shopping or painting! We prefer a minimum age of 13 years of age. **Please see requirements for lessons and activities.**

Whilst all children will be supervised at all times, they are also allowed to have some 'free time' to catch up with family and friends or read a book/play on their computer etc. We have an electric keyboard here too for any budding musicians! We can tailor stays to meet parental requirements.

**Full Board Immersion holidays stays require an hour of formal or informal structured lessons to be booked per day. You can book additional lessons if you wish - however we strongly advise no more than 2 hours a day for under 16's. Please message me if this isn't suitable for your needs and we can discuss.

**NB: Full Board Immersion holidays also require a minimum of 3 paid activities to be booked for all stays of 5 days of over. If the listed activities do not appeal to you please feel free to discuss other options with us.

The Full Board Immersion option is available for 18-25's, adults and seniors as well, but for those who want to have more time to themselves, we also offer these age groups a B&B option.

**The B&B option requires 1 hour a day of informal lessons to be booked per day . You can book more lessons if you wish.

**If you wish it book additional paid activities along with your B&B stay please feel free to do so**

---Please note that on the B&B option, where no activities are booked, we expect that guests will be out and about during the majority of the day/evening, visiting the local area and we can not offer self catering for B&B guests. Your English immersion experience :
A typical day with us

Our normal day consists of breakfast around 8am – what’s on offer?? Cereal/toast/youghurt/fruits – we follow a gluten-free diet but can cater to other requirements. Then structured classes in the morning (these can be formal grammar and vocabulary lessons or more informal conversational lessons with practical tasks like cooking).
Lunches are kept light, sandwiches/eggs benedict/omelettes etc, so you are not too full to enjoy the afternoon activities!
Aside from the paid activities we also have a heated pool at home, a few bicycles – with miles of local cycling paths to explore and about 1.9 hectares of land to wander around, including a small wooded area.
Got some frustrations to work out? Have a go at one of our boxing bags in the barn (gloves and helmets provided) and test your skills on our balance board.
You can also help with the horses if you wish to! For older students who fancy trying their hand at other diy tasks – we have lots of walls that need chauxing, fences that need building and endless gardening to do!
Then perhaps a film in the evening (in English of course, but we can pop subtitles on so you are not completely lost!) or maybe some board games and we have quite a lot of English books you can browse through. We find that people learn and improve their language skills just as well outside the classroom environment,
So whether we are cooking at home, boating along the Marais Poitivan, splashing around at O'Gliss or lounging around our pool, you can gain in confidence, improve your fluency and expand your vocabulary whilst having fun at the same time!
